Address 0 PPC

PQUF62nykL8JT7zkoysVmdsWcEwngT195k

Confirmed

Total Received47.788511 PPC
Total Sent47.788511 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PQUF62nykL8JT7zkoysVmdsWcEwngT195k47.788511 PPC
Fee: 0.01 PPC
691192 Confirmations47.778511 PPC
PQUF62nykL8JT7zkoysVmdsWcEwngT195k47.788511 PPC
PCPJ1cwBSYZ8wA1zHztxcsjwLgqXUqMZh63.587696 PPC
Fee: 0.01 PPC
691199 Confirmations51.376207 PPC